This game is roguelite with spell merge. It's about Ray's story, who is a young witch trying to find her mother in the tower. You climb a tower, collect spell cards and relics to make yourself stronger. Then when you lose, you gain memory shard which can be used for upgrade, and spell card that you can use to merge cards to discover new spells to use in tower. I got inspired by many roguelike games such as Hades, Slay the Spire, and also old school classic jrpg game(such as TGL) that allowed me to have great childhood with.

What software you using for everything

1

u/NotaDevAI Aug 05 '26

If you mean by game engine, im using godot 4.6. For art, using chatty with some level of retouching through photoshop, background music, suno. For effect graphic and sound, i purchased some assets or used open source asset. :)
